Detailed explanation-1: -In computing, WYSIWYG (/ˈwɪziwɪɡ/ WIZ-ee-wig), an acronym for What You See Is What You Get, is a system in which editing software allows content to be edited in a form that resembles its appearance when printed or displayed as a finished product, such as a printed document, web page, or slide presentation.
Detailed explanation-2: -Web Page Editor is an application that can help you build a website in an easy and convenient manner. The WYSIWYG principle, in which what you see is what you get, is the basis for most website software. This eliminates the need for coding and allows users to craft their websites with a visual approach.
